]> git.openstreetmap.org Git - rails.git/blobdiff - app/assets/javascripts/index.js
Fix add note
[rails.git] / app / assets / javascripts / index.js
index d58317f63f8b12aaaa5c75c0dd12359984789174..7988541a680fb4b12d8d13d044a544d2cae49ff4 100644 (file)
@@ -75,11 +75,6 @@ $(document).ready(function () {
     sidebar: sidebar
   }).addTo(map);
 
-  L.OSM.note({
-    position: 'topright',
-    sidebar: sidebar
-  }).addTo(map);
-
   L.OSM.share({
     getShortUrl: getShortUrl,
     getUrl: getUrl,
@@ -87,6 +82,11 @@ $(document).ready(function () {
     short: true
   }).addTo(map);
 
+  L.OSM.note({
+    position: 'topright',
+    sidebar: sidebar
+  }).addTo(map);
+
   L.control.scale()
     .addTo(map);
 
@@ -169,36 +169,10 @@ $(document).ready(function () {
   initializeNotes(map);
 });
 
-function getMapBaseLayerId(map) {
-  for (var i in map._layers) { // TODO: map.eachLayer
-    var layer = map._layers[i];
-    if (layer.options && layer.options.keyid) {
-      return layer.options.keyid;
-    }
-  }
-}
-
-function getMapLayers(map) {
-  var layerConfig = '';
-  for (var i in map._layers) { // TODO: map.eachLayer
-    var layer = map._layers[i];
-    if (layer.options && layer.options.code) {
-      layerConfig += layer.options.code;
-    }
-  }
-  return layerConfig;
-}
-
-// generate a cookie-safe string of map state
-function cookieContent(map) {
-  var center = map.getCenter().wrap();
-  return [center.lng, center.lat, map.getZoom(), getMapLayers(map)].join('|');
-}
-
 function updateLocation() {
   updatelinks(this.getCenter().wrap(),
       this.getZoom(),
-      getMapLayers(this),
+      this.getLayersCode(),
       this.getBounds().wrap(), {});
 
   var expiry = new Date();